Dressing, a Drabble of Reiassan
Nov. 27th, 2011 10:50 pmAfter "Is this a Kissing Fic?" but before "Talking with Mom."
"My underwear are showing."
Girey tugged on his quitari, trying to get it to lie properly. The formal tunic had several more layers to it than the simple garb they'd been wearing on the road, and it would probably look very nice on him, if he'd stop fiddling.
Rin hid a smile and moved to help him. "Your undershirt is supposed to show. It's got that embroidery on it, see?"
"Bitrani under-tunics have embroidery, too, but it's not for the public to see." He wrinkled his nose and tugged his outer shirt down again.
"Trust me, here people want to see this work. It's showing off your wealth - or, in your case, my wealth."
"Oh, joy." He frowned uncomfortably down at her. "What, you can afford to dress me up?"
"And myself up." She held her arms out, so he could see how her outfit flowed on her. "Besides, we'd be insulting Elin if we didn't dress our best for her wedding."
"I thought you didn't like her." He let his arms fall to his sides, watching her.
"Oh, come on, you know politics better than that." She smoothed down the front of his tunic, making sure the extensive embroidery showed properly. "Girey, just smile and pretend you don't know the language if you get uncomfortable."
He smirked dryly at her. "If I did that," he pointed out, "I'd never have another conversation in Callanthe."
